What moves Backend Developer pay

Seniority

Years of experience and scope are the biggest lever — senior backend developer roles routinely clear the top of the range above.

Company & industry

Larger and high-margin employers pay more for the same backend developer title than smaller or non-profit ones.

Local market

Cost of living and local demand shift Washington, DC offers up or down versus the national figure.
